Kurz v. Fidelity Mgmt. and Research Co., 08-2733

In a breach of contract action involving securities, district court's denial of motion to remand and judgment in favor of defendant is affirmed where: 1) the plaintiff's claim about the misconduct of defendant's employees in regards to securities trades was a securities law issue and the proceeding belonged in federal court under the Securities Litigation Uniform Standards Act; and 2) plaintiff filed suit after the federal statute of limitations had run and was unable to show injury.
